Honeymoon in Cape Town: Who Killed Anni Dewani?
On the night of November 13, 2010, newlyweds Anni and Shrien Dewani were riding through Cape Town when their taxi was hijacked in Gugulethu township. Shrien was forced out of the car. Anni was not. Hours later, her body was found in the abandoned vehicle — shot once in the neck. Helle Crafts: The Woodchipper Murder That Made Connecticut Legal History (ft. Annie Elise)
Before Helle Crafts disappeared, she told four different people the exact same thing: "If anything happens to me, do not believe it is an accident."
On November 18th, 1986, the 39-year-old Pan Am flight attendant and mother of three walked into her Newtown, Connecticut home... and was never seen again.

Into the Desert: The Disappearance of Daniel Robinson
On June 23, 2021, twenty-four-year-old geologist Daniel Robinson drove his Jeep out to a work site in the Arizona desert near Buckeye and vanished. His vehicle was found weeks later, rolled down a ravine miles from where he'd last been seen. His remains have never been found. Egypt Covington: The Wrong House Killing
On the night of June 22nd, 2017, 27-year-old Egypt Covington went to yoga, texted her boyfriend goodnight, and went to bed. The next evening, he found her on the floor of her living room... tied up with Christmas lights... killed by a single gunshot wound to the head. It was the middle of June.
No forced entry. No robbery. No obvious motive.

Inga Gehricke: The Girl Who Vanished in the German Woods
On May 2nd, 2015, five-year-old Inga Gehricke disappeared from a family barbecue in the remote German countryside.
More than 1,000 people searched the forest. Helicopters scanned 8,600 acres. Search dogs tracked for days. They didn’t find a single trace.
Nearly a decade later, investigators still have no physical evidence. So what happened to Inga?

Nanette Krentel: Murder Beneath the Bayou Smoke
In July 2017, 49-year-old Nanette Krentel was found inside her burning home in Lacombe, Louisiana. At first, it appeared to be a tragic house fire. But an autopsy revealed a shocking detail: Nanette had been shot in the head before the fire began and there was no soot in her lungs.

The Disappearance of Gail Katz-Bierenbaum: A Letter That Predicted the Future
In July 1985, 29 year-old Gail Katz-Bierenbaum told a friend she was leaving her husband. She had apartment listings circled, money borrowed, and a psychiatrist’s written warning that her husband might kill her.
The next day, she vanished.

Robert Pickton: A Serial Killer and a Farm Full of Secrets
In the 1990s, women began disappearing from Vancouver’s Downtown East Side: many of them Indigenous, many of them sex workers, many of them dismissed as transient or unreliable. A survivor of a violent 1997 attack identified her assailant as pig farmer Robert Pickton, but the charges were stayed and the investigation stalled. Ellen Greenberg: A Locked Door, 20 Stab Wounds, and No Clear Answers
In 2011, 27 year-old teacher Ellen Greenberg was found dead in her Philadelphia apartment with twenty stab wounds, ten of them in her back, and a knife still lodged in her chest. The door was locked from the inside, the room spotless, and the investigation quickly shifted from homicide to suicide, despite bruises, conflicting evidence, and a crime scene that was cleaned within hours. The Oslo Woman: The Case That Still Haunts Norway
In 1995, a woman checked into Oslo’s Plaza Hotel under a false name, carrying almost nothing and leaving behind no trace of who she really was. Three days later, a gunshot echoed from Room 2805. Inside, she lay dead with no ID, no fingerprints on the weapon, and every clothing label carefully cut away. The Somerton Man Case: The Death No One Could Explain
In 1948, a well-dressed man was found dead on an Australian beach: no ID, no name, and a note in his pocket with the words “Tamam Shud”. For decades, investigators chased theories of spies, secret codes, and poisons, but the case stayed cold. INFAMOUS: Salem Witch Trials
The Salem Witch Trials weren’t just about witches: they were about power, fear, and survival. In 1692, hundreds were accused, dozens imprisoned, and twenty executed in a frenzy that gripped New England.
